Freeze dryer installation and commissioning

Bringing a freeze dryer chamber into a 2-storey building
GEA
Lyophil’s services do not end after the freeze dryer has left our works.
Depending on customers’ requirements our service engineers are at their site to
help install and commission the freeze drying equipment. Especially for
complete systems including ALUS and isolators a correct levelling is crucial.
Due to long lasting experience these experts can help to facilitate
installation and shorten the time to get the equipment running.

Spare parts
Requiring superior
quality to grant a trouble-free operation of our freeze dryers, GEA Lyophil
only uses parts and components of well-known manufacturers, which have proven
their compliance and reliability with the pharmaceutical freeze drying
technology.
This does not only apply to the manufacturing of our freeze
dryers, but to the spare parts as well. GEA Lyophil has a stock of original
spare parts, which in case of an emergency can be shipped by overnight courier
in order to minimize downtimes.
For every freeze dryer, ALUS, isolator
or CIP-Skid leaving our works, GEA Lyophil offers a spare parts package
tailored specially to the equipment. In case of need the customer thus has a
necessary spare part at hands to carry out the repair.
Maintenance Contracts
Regularly preventive
maintenance helps to avoid unexpected downtimes. Therefore GEA Lyophil offers
maintenance contracts covering a service engineer’s visit every 6 or 12 months,
depending on the customer’s requirements. During these visits all wear parts
are exchanged and the function of all components is checked. A terminal plant
tests proves the trouble-free operation of the freeze dryer.
Training
It is not only a trouble-free functioning of
freeze dryers, that grants a smoothly running production process, but personnel
who are acquainted with their operation.
GEA Lyophil does not forget
the humans working with the equipment. Well-trained staff who know the freeze
drying process, the mechanical and the electrical function of the freeze dryer
and the necessary maintenance work is essential for the pharmaceutical
production process.
GEA Lyophil offers training programmes for
operators and maintenance personnel tailored to the customer’s requirements.
Based on the customer’s freeze dryer configuration these trainings cover design
and function of the main components, for example refrigeration skid, vacuum
pumps and control system as well as fundamentals of the freeze drying process.
